The Evolution of Car Keys
Car keys have come a long way since the early days of automotive history. At first, car keys were easy mechanical gadgets. Nevertheless, with the advent of innovation, they have become more sophisticated and safe. Today, there are a number of types of car keys, each needing specialized knowledge and tools:
Traditional Metal Keys: These are the most basic and the majority of standard kind of car keys. They are used to lock and open the car's doors and fire up the engine. A locksmith can easily duplicate these keys utilizing a key-cutting maker.
Transponder Keys: These keys consist of a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system to permit the engine to start. Duplicating and programming a transponder key is more complex and needs customized equipment.
Remote Head Keys: These keys have a remote control integrated into the key head, allowing the driver to lock and unlock the car from a distance. A locksmith can program the remote functions of these keys.
Keyless Entry and Start Systems: Modern lorries typically include keyless entry and start systems, which use a fob or a smart device app to unlock and start the car. Locksmiths can assist with the programming and troubleshooting of these systems.
Smart Keys: These keys are extremely advanced and can carry out several functions, such as beginning the car, locking and opening doors, and adjusting seat positions. Locksmiths require to be fluent in the newest technologies to work with smart keys.
Tools of the Trade
Locksmiths use a range of tools to perform their tasks. Some of the necessary tools for car key services consist of:
- Key Cutting Machines: These devices are used to duplicate conventional metal keys and the metal parts of transponder keys.
- Key Programming Tools: These tools enable locksmiths to program the microchips in transponder and clever keys.
- Decoders and Diagnostics Tools: These gadgets assist locksmiths detect problems with the car's electronic systems and guarantee that brand-new keys are correctly programmed.
- Lock Picking Tools: While mostly utilized for lock repair and opening locks without keys, these tools can also be beneficial in specific car key circumstances.
- Laser Cutters: Some high-security keys need precision cutting, which is achieved utilizing laser cutters.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How long does it require to replicate a car key?
A: Duplicating a standard metal key can take simply a couple of minutes. Nevertheless, programming a transponder or smart key can use up to an hour, depending on the complexity of the key and the locksmith's equipment.
Q: Can a locksmith program a key for a car with a keyless entry system?
A: Yes, locksmiths can program keys for automobiles with keyless entry systems. They use specialized programming tools and typically need to access the car's on-board computer system to complete the job.
Q: What should I do if I lose my car key and do not have a spare?
A: If you lose your car key and don't have a spare, the best course of action is to call an expert locksmith. They can produce a new key and program it to work with your vehicle's security system.
Q: How much does it cost to get a car key programmed by a locksmith?
A: The expense of programming a car key can vary depending upon the type of key and the make and model of the vehicle. Usually, it can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 or more.
Q: Can I program a car key myself?
A: Some cars permit DIY key programming, but this is frequently a complex procedure that can cause mistakes. It is typically suggested to look for the help of an expert locksmith to ensure that the key is programmed correctly.
Q: Are locksmiths trained to work with all types of automobiles?
A: Most expert locksmith professionals are trained to deal with a large range of vehicle makes and models. However, it is constantly a great concept to verify that the locksmith has experience with your specific kind of car.
